How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Southeast Antioch?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Southeast Antioch Studio Apartments | $1,600 | $899 | $3,700 |
Southeast Antioch 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,467 | $912 | $4,121 |
Southeast Antioch 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,813 | $999 | $4,999 |
Southeast Antioch 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,318 | $1,393 | $6,123 |
Southeast Antioch 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,500 | $2,500 | $2,500 |
